Diesel Fleet Technician II at Sysco Seattle - Kent

Role Overview

As a Diesel Fleet Technician II at Sysco Seattle - Kent, you will play a vital role in ensuring the safe and reliable operation of our fleet vehicles. This involves performing comprehensive inspections, preventive maintenance, and expert repairs on a variety of vehicles, including tractors, trailers, and light-duty trucks. Your primary goal will be to minimize vehicle downtime, improve fleet reliability, and maintain cost-efficiency.

This position requires a strong understanding of diesel engine mechanics, electrical systems, and hydraulic systems, as well as the ability to diagnose and repair complex issues. You will also be responsible for adhering to all federal, state, and local regulations related to vehicle maintenance and safety.

A Day in the Life

Here’s what a typical day might look like for a Diesel Fleet Technician II:

  • Morning: Begin by reviewing work orders and prioritizing tasks based on urgency and importance. Conduct thorough inspections of vehicles, identifying any potential maintenance needs or safety concerns.
  • Mid-day: Perform preventive maintenance tasks such as oil changes, filter replacements, and brake adjustments. Diagnose and repair mechanical and electrical issues, utilizing diagnostic software and specialized tools.
  • Afternoon: Address Driver Vehicle Inspection Report write-ups promptly and efficiently. Complete repair work on engines, transmissions, and other vehicle components. Document all work performed on work orders, ensuring accurate records are maintained.
  • Throughout the Day: Collaborate with other technicians and fleet managers to coordinate repairs and maintenance schedules. Stay up-to-date on the latest industry trends and technologies through training and professional development opportunities.

Career Path

The Diesel Fleet Technician II position offers a clear path for career advancement within Sysco. With experience and proven performance, you can progress to roles such as:

  • Diesel Fleet Technician III: A senior-level technician with advanced diagnostic and repair skills.
  • Lead Technician: Supervises and mentors a team of technicians, overseeing the day-to-day operations of the maintenance shop.
  • Fleet Manager: Responsible for the overall management and maintenance of the fleet, including budgeting, scheduling, and regulatory compliance.

FAQ

  1. What are the essential qualifications for this role?

    The essential qualifications include medium/heavy duty truck technical training, a high school diploma or GED, 2-year school and 1 year of experience or 3 years of experience in fleet maintenance and repair, and a current and valid driver's license.

  2. What certifications are preferred?

    ASE certifications in automotive or medium/heavy duty trucks are preferred but not required. Annual Inspector and Brake Inspector certifications are also highly valued.

  3. What kind of tools do I need to provide?

    You must provide your own tools necessary to perform maintenance repair and diagnostics. Diagnostic equipment and major tools are provided by Sysco.

  4. What type of vehicles will I be working on?

    You will be working on a variety of fleet vehicles including tractors, trailers, converter dollies, lift-gates, light-duty vehicles, and other company-owned equipment.

  5. What are the key responsibilities of this role?

    Key responsibilities include performing inspections, preventive maintenance, diagnosing malfunctions, performing repairs, and documenting work orders.
